Webb12 apr. 2024 · The Prelude(Book I) The subtitle of The Preludeis ‘Growth of a Poet’s Mind’. William Wordsworth(1770-1850) began writing his autobiographical blank verse epic in 1798, working on it intermittently until 1839. It was published posthumously in 1850. Regular rhythm gives a natural quality as though narrator is using everyday speech, makes dramatic experience sound more … WebbThe Prelude Stealing the Boat by William Wordsworth April 19th, 2024 - The Prelude Stealing the Boat by William Wordsworth Taught alongside teaching of AQA English … Webb'a little boat tied to a willow tree' starts with a happy, rural image. tranquil, calm and natural. 'act of stealth' knows what he is doing something wrong- hinting that something bad is going to happen. 'troubled pleasure' oxymoron, he is taking an exciting risk, knows what he is doing is and but it feels good 'glittering' 'sparkling light' green grass clipart free
